Output c95fb7265c08281f63a8f2d009f7ae11d16ec28dfb9f1bc664c094943734bd9e:9

value
8468536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980a398ef8f5335a89b3a50eddca0dacfa56de68 OP_EQUAL
address
3FYvt8rK8kGpZouykNtHstZVB78UsuA61G
transaction
c95fb7265c08281f63a8f2d009f7ae11d16ec28dfb9f1bc664c094943734bd9e
spent
true